Output Ranges and Autoranging
The 662xA’s outputs are limited
to two ranges of voltage and
current. For example, the 40 W
Low Voltage output is limited
to 40 Watts or less within the
two “rectangular” ranges of
0-7 V / 0-5 A and 0-20 V / 0-2 A.
The N67xxA modules, however,
can produce any combination
of voltage and current within
their maximum voltage and cur-
rent specification as long as it
falls at or below its maximum
power rating
the 50 W High Performance
Autoranging DC Power Module
(N6751A), which replaces the
40 W Low and High Voltage out-
puts in the 662xAs, can output
any combination of 50 Watts or

Protection Features
Overvoltage Protection
(OV or OVP)
On the 662xA models, the OV
trip point can be programmed
up to 23 V on any 40 W or 80 W
Low Voltage Output and up to
55 V on any 40 W or 80 W High
Voltage Output as well as the
25 W and 50 W precision out-
puts. The overvoltage protection
shorts the output by firing an
SCR crowbar and sets zero
volts and minimal current on
the output. The 662xA also has
a fixed overvoltage threshold
of approximately 120% of the
maximum rated output voltage
built into each output. When
an overvoltage occurs, the word
OVERVOLTAGE appears in the
front panel display and the OV
status bit is set for that output.
